当前位置: 首页 手游资讯 服务器资讯

dns服务器配置笔记

dns服务器配置笔记

DNS服务器配置笔记

DNS(Domain Name System)服务器是用于解析域名和IP地址之间对应关系的服务器。在进行网络通信时通过域名可以更方便地访问网站,DNS服务器则负责将域名转换为相应的IP地址。下面是关于DNS服务器配置的一些笔记,希望能够对大家有所帮助。

1. DNS服务器的作用和原理:

DNS服务器的作用是将域名解析为相应的IP地址,使得用户可以通过域名访问网站。DNS服务器工作的基本原理是通过域名查询到相应的IP地址并将结果缓存起来,以便下次查询时可以快速获取。

2. DNS服务器的分类:

DNS服务器按照功能和区域划分可以分为递归DNS服务器和权威DNS服务器。

- 递归DNS服务器:也称为本地DNS服务器,负责向上级DNS服务器查询域名解析结果并将结果返回给客户端。

- 权威DNS服务器:也称为域名服务器,存储着特定域名的解析记录并负责响应其他DNS服务器或客户端的解析请求。

3. DNS服务器配置步骤:

- 安装DNS服务器软件:常见的DNS服务器软件有BIND、PowerDNS等,根据需求选择合适的软件进行安装。

- 配置主机名和IP地址:在配置DNS服务器前,需要先为服务器配置一个唯一的主机名和静态的IP地址。

- 修改DNS服务器配置文件:DNS服务器软件通过配置文件来设置服务器的具体功能和参数,根据软件的不同,配置文件的位置和格式会有所不同。

- 添加解析记录:在权威DNS服务器上添加相应的解析记录,将域名与IP地址进行绑定。

- 设置转发器(可选):如果本地DNS服务器无法解析某些域名,可以设置转发器,将这部分域名的解析请求转发给其他可靠的DNS服务器。

4. 注意事项:

- 配置正确的主机名和IP地址非常重要,确保服务器可以正常与网络通信。

- 在配置解析记录时需要注意记录的类型(如A记录、CNAME记录等)和TTL(Time-To-Live)的设置,以便适应业务需求。

- 定期清理DNS服务器的缓存,防止缓存中的解析记录过期或不准确。

- 对于大型网站或高流量网站,可以考虑配置DNS负载均衡,将解析请求分发到多个服务器上,提高解析的效率和可靠性。

5. 调试和故障处理:

- 使用nslookup或dig等工具进行域名解析测试,检查解析结果是否与预期一致。

- 注意查看DNS服务器的日志文件,以便发现和解决潜在的问题。

- 如果出现解析延迟或解析失败的情况,可以尝试清空DNS缓存、重启DNS服务器或联系网络运营商进行排查。

dns服务器配置的作用是

DNS服务器配置的作用是

DNS服务器配置是指对DNS服务器进行相应设置,以确保DNS系统正常运行并提供准确的域名解析服务。DNS服务器配置起着至关重要的作用,影响了用户在互联网上访问网站的速度和准确性。本文将从以下几个方面介绍DNS服务器配置的作用。

DNS服务器配置可以提高用户访问网站的速度。在互联网上,每个域名都对应一个IP地址,当用户在浏览器中输入域名时浏览器会向DNS服务器发起请求,获取对应的IP地址。如果DNS服务器配置不合理,那么解析域名所需的时间就会变长,导致用户访问网站的速度变慢。通过合理配置DNS服务器,可以选择高效的解析算法和合适的缓存策略,提高域名解析的速度,减少用户等待时间。

DNS服务器配置可以防止恶意攻击和域名劫持。在互联网上,存在一些恶意网站和黑客,他们会利用DNS服务器的漏洞或弱点进行攻击,比如域名劫持和DNS劫持。通过合理配置DNS服务器,可以加强服务器的安全性,提高抵御恶意攻击的能力。常见的配置包括设置防火墙、限制访问权限、定期更新DNS服务器的软件和补丁等。

DNS服务器配置还可以提供灵活的域名解析策略。在互联网上,不同的域名可能需要不同的解析策略,比如将特定的域名映射到多个IP地址,实现负载均衡或故障恢复。通过合理配置DNS服务器,可以实现这些高级解析策略,提供更灵活的域名解析服务。

DNS服务器配置还可以实现本地区域网络的域名解析。在企业或大型组织的本地网络中,通常会配置本地DNS服务器,为内部的计算机提供域名解析服务。通过合理配置本地DNS服务器,可以提高内部网络的访问速度和稳定性,同时可以实现对内部域名和外部域名的统一管理。

DNS服务器配置还可以提供统计和日志功能。通过对DNS服务器进行配置,可以记录用户的域名解析请求和响应信息,以便进行统计和分析。这些统计和日志信息对于网络管理人员来说非常有价值,可以帮助他们了解网络的使用情况,及时发现和解决一些潜在的问题。

dns服务器配置

DNS服务器配置

DNS(Domain Name System)是互联网中常用的一种网络服务,将域名与IP地址之间建立映射关系,方便用户通过域名访问网站。要使用DNS服务,首先需要进行DNS服务器配置。

DNS服务器配置的过程通常包括以下几个步骤:

1. 选择合适的DNS服务器:在配置DNS服务器之前,需要选择一个合适的DNS服务器。常用的DNS服务器有公共的DNS服务器和专用的DNS服务器。公共的DNS服务器由互联网服务提供商(ISP)或其他网络服务提供商维护,们一般免费提供给用户使用。而专用的DNS服务器则是用户自己搭建和管理的服务器。

2. 配置DNS服务器的IP地址:配置DNS服务器的第一步是为其分配一个IP地址。IP地址是DNS服务器在网络中唯一的标识符,其他设备通过这个IP地址来与DNS服务器通信。IP地址可以是IPv4或IPv6的格式,具体选用哪种格式取决于网络环境和需求。

3. 配置DNS服务器的域名:在DNS服务器配置中,还需要配置其域名。域名是DNS服务器的标识符,用于标识DNS服务器的名称和位置。域名通常包括主机名和域名后缀,例如"server.example.com"。配置域名的过程通常需要在DNS服务器的控制面板进行操作。

4. 配置DNS服务器的缓存:DNS服务器通常会缓存DNS查询的结果,以提高查询的速度和减轻网络负载。在DNS服务器配置中,可以设置缓存的大小和生存时间。较大的缓存可以存储更多的查询结果,但也会占用更多的内存空间。而较长的生存时间可以减少DNS查询的次数,但也可能导致已过期的结果被使用。

5. 配置DNS服务器的转发:有时候,DNS服务器无法直接解析某些域名,就需要进行转发。在DNS服务器配置中,可以设置转发规则,将无法解析的查询转发给其他DNS服务器。转发可以是递归的,也可以是迭代的。递归转发是指DNS服务器直接向其他DNS服务器发起查询,直到获取到结果;而迭代转发是指DNS服务器将查询结果返回给请求的设备,由设备自行向其他DNS服务器查询。

6. 配置DNS服务器的安全性:DNS服务器配置还需要考虑安全性问题。可以设置访问控制列表(ACL)来限制访问DNS服务器的设备和用户。还可以启用安全套接层(SSL)协议来加密DNS查询和响应。可以使用DNSSEC(DNS Security Extensions)来验证域名的真实性和完整性,防止域名劫持等安全问题。

声明:

1、本文来源于互联网,所有内容仅代表作者本人的观点,与本网站立场无关,作者文责自负。

2、本网站部份内容来自互联网收集整理,对于不当转载或引用而引起的民事纷争、行政处理或其他损失,本网不承担责任。

3、如果有侵权内容、不妥之处,请第一时间联系我们删除,请联系

  1. 玛法英雄之烈火VS侠侣情缘九游版
  2. 阴阳双剑7477版VS武装掠夺手机版
  3. 小男孩跑酷冒险VS泡泡太空杀
  4. 音舞大作战VS挂机吧小精灵删档封测版本
  5. 全民猜歌王VS我的人生
  6. 武士道骑士HDVS橙光升官当皇帝
  7. 子弹雨游戏VS永恒岛安卓中文版
  8. 抖音奇迹大冒险VS剑誓情缘官方版
  9. JOJO光碟战争VS仙魔尘缘手游
  10. 恐龙大战原始人安卓版VS大主宰之剑侠情
  11. 逃离内华达VS凡人寻仙路最新版
  12. 公主连结redive台服最新客户端VS甜瓜梦境游乐场最新版